How to Create a Media Wall With Fireplace and Shelves Media walls are growing in popularity due to their combination of practical charm and aesthetic appeal. They can be a customized entertainment center and can be designed to fit any style of home. There are a variety of shelving options to display vessels and keepsakes, in addition to cabinets that can conceal audio and video equipment. The key to a custom media wall is the integration of storage solutions that complement your personal style. Shelving A media wall is a great location to keep your books and other items and also create a focal focal point in your living room. The variety of shelving options means that you can customize your media wall to match your style and storage requirements. The material you choose for your shelving and design will influence the overall look of your media wall. For instance open shelves are ideal for display purposes while cabinets are great for storage. If you're looking for a contemporary industrial look metal shelves are an excellent option, while solid wood shelving provides a more traditional aesthetic. If you're planning on building a media wall, start by sketching out the outline of the frame. This will help you visualize your plan and make any necessary adjustments prior starting construction. You'll need to buy the necessary tools and materials, including lumber for the base or drywall for walls. Be sure to read the instructions provided by the manufacturer and use a level as well as a stud finder for accurate measurements. After you've built the fundamental structure then apply primer and paint the frame to give it an even color. Allow the paint to fully dry prior to adding any other components, such as cabinets or shelves. Installing a custom electric fire to your media wall allows you to take pleasure in the aesthetics of stunning flames while keeping your television and other electronic devices protected from the heat. Electric fires utilize an element of heating that is forced by a fan to draw cool air into the fireplace, heat it, and then push warm air out, keeping them from becoming too hot to touch. They also don't require a chimney or vent, which makes them an ideal option for media walls. If you'd rather not be heating up the fire, think about a recessed one with a remote control LED mood lighting system. This lighting can be controlled with the remote control of the fireplace or TV, giving you the flexibility to create the perfect ambience.
